Gain a comprehensive understanding of the Antarctic Treaty System through this specialized Executive Certificate in Antarctic Treaty System Evaluation. The program delves into the complexities of environmental protection, scientific research governance, and international cooperation within the Antarctic context.
Learning outcomes include mastering the principles of the Antarctic Treaty System, developing skills in treaty compliance evaluation, and analyzing environmental impact assessments relevant to Antarctic activities. Participants will also gain proficiency in conflict resolution and negotiation strategies within the unique geopolitical landscape of Antarctica.
